JOB SUMMARY:Â
The Registered Nurse Educator II supports the quality of care provided to patients by Department of Nursing staff through optimal orientation programs, ongoing evaluation of competence, and support of lifelong learning. The RN Nurse Educator II promotes relevant professional development opportunities and mentorship for members of the department of nursing at all levels to assist with the achievement of personal and professional goals. The RN Educator II will identify outcomes of educational interventions based on input from learners and stakeholders, evidence, regulations and organizational goals.

ABOUT PENN STATE HEALTH:Â
Penn State Health is one of the leading teaching and research hospitals in the country. It is a multi-hospital health system, Academic Medical Center and Level 1 adult and pediatric trauma center serving patients and communities across Central Pennsylvania. The system includes Penn State Health Milton S. Hershey Medical Center, Penn State Children's Hospital, and Penn State Cancer Institute in scenic Hershey, PA. It also includes Penn State Health Saint Joseph's Medical Center in Reading, PA, Penn State Health Holy Spirit Medical Center in Camp Hill, PA, and Penn State Health Hampden Medical Center in Enola, PA. Penn State Health shares an integrated strategic plan and operations with Penn State College of Medicine.Â
